Mice sera injected with DNA were assessed for the production of IL-10 at the end of 10 days of experiment. 100ul of 1:2 diluted serum samples were used.

Experimental Design and Results Summary

Application

Determination of IL-10 from serum samples

Starting Material

Mouse serum from tail bleeds

Protocol Overview

For coating, PBS was used instead of carb/bicarb buffer. 100ul of 1:2 diluted serum samples were used. Incubations were done as indicated in manufacturer's protocol.

Tips

PBS should be used and not carb/bicarb buffer for coating.

Results Summary

Kit detected picograms of IL-10 and was specific.

Summary

The Good

Detects even small quantities as low as 15 pgs

The Bad

Nothing really

The Bottom Line

Good kit but care has to be taken not to use carb/bicarb buffer as manufacturer's site lists using this buffer on one link and using PBS on the other. Only works well with PBS.
